Specializations in Dentistry
Dentistry is a broad field encompassing various specializations that cater to different aspects of oral health. General dentists often handle routine care, such as cleanings, fillings, and exams, while specialists focus on specific areas. For instance, orthodontists are dedicated to aligning teeth and correcting bites using braces and other devices, while periodontists specialize in the prevention and treatment of gum disease. Additionally, oral surgeons manage complex cases requiring surgical intervention, such as wisdom tooth extractions and jaw surgeries. Choosing the right specialist can significantly impact your oral health and overall well-being.
The Importance of Regular Dental Visits
Regular dental visits are an essential component of maintaining good oral hygiene, as they allow for early detection and treatment of potential issues. During these appointments, dentists conduct thorough examinations and provide professional cleanings to remove plaque and tartar buildup. Moreover, they can offer tailored advice on at-home care practices to optimize your dental health.
